CH50 is only clinically significant iwhen the values are low which could indicate a problem with the complement cascade or an immunological disease. The total complement (CH50) assay (COM / Complement, Total, Serum) assesses the classical complement pathway including early components that activate the pathway in response to immune complexes (C1q, C2 and C4), as well as the terminal complement components (C3, C5, C6, C7, C8, C9) involved in the formation of the membrane attack complex (MAC). Low levels of total complement (total hemolytic complement: CH50) may occur during infections, disease exacerbation in patients with systemic lupus erythematosus, and in patients with immune complex diseases such as glomerulonephritis. The CH50 is a screening assay for the activation of the classical complement pathway (Fig 1) and it is sensitive to the reduction, absence and/or inactivity of any component of the pathway. Complement deficiencies are rare but there are well defined associations of immune dysfunction, both susceptibility to infection and autoimmune disease, with various complement disorders. Decreased complement levels are found in infectious and autoimmune diseases due to fixation and consumption of complement.
